This is a well situated luxury hotel with professional, courteous staff and amazingly comfortable rooms and beds. Occasional good discounts through overseas websites make this a best value for me in Florence.

Great hotel with fantastic location within walking distance of the Duomo. Rooms were great, clean and spacious. The staff couldn't have been more helpful.
